Amazon's share of the US ecommerce market has now surpassed 49 percent, making it the most popular platform for online retailers. In 2017, $31.88 billion of the revenue generated on Amazon came from third-party sellers. Even better news for third-party sellers is that as of Q3 2018, more than 50 percent of paid units sold on Amazon were sold by third-party sellers. This ecommerce marketplace provides a platform that helps many retailers hit and surpass their sales goals.
But success on Amazon requires ecommerce retailers to be able to effectively manage orders, shipments, and inventory. Most companies use an ERP system to do so, with SAP Business One being one of the most popular ERP systems for small and mid-sized businesses.
Manually synchronizing data between SAP Business One and Amazon is time-consuming and inefficient. It also increases the chance for errors, which can result in unfulfilled orders and unhappy customers. Companies could pay a consultant to automate integration, but that approach typically comes with a high price tag and can take months to complete. Businesses miss out on potential sales while they are waiting for these long integration projects to be completed.
